Understanding Electric Bike Range Key Factors and Considerations


The rise of electric bikes (e-bikes) has transformed the cycling landscape, offering a more accessible and flexible alternative to traditional bicycles. A common question among potential e-bike users is “What is the range of an electric bike?” Range refers to the distance an e-bike can travel on a single charge, and it varies significantly based on several factors. In this article, we will explore the elements that influence electric bike range, helping you make an informed decision when choosing an e-bike.


1. Battery Capacity


One of the most critical factors affecting an electric bike's range is its battery capacity, usually measured in watt-hours (Wh). The higher the watt-hour rating, the more energy the battery can store, resulting in a more extended range. E-bike batteries typically range from 250Wh to 700Wh or more. For instance, an e-bike equipped with a 500Wh battery can potentially offer a range of 30-70 miles, depending on various conditions.


2. Motor Power and Assistance Levels


E-bikes come with different motor specifications, typically rated between 250W to 750W or higher. The power of the motor influences how much assistance you receive when pedaling. More powerful motors can provide greater assistance, especially when climbing hills or accelerating. However, increased power often leads to higher energy consumption, which can reduce the overall range of the bike. Additionally, e-bikes offer various assistance levels, allowing riders to choose how much power they want to utilize. Riding in a lower assistance mode will extend your range compared to using maximum assistance.


3. Riding Conditions


The environment in which you ride plays a significant role in determining your e-bike’s range. Factors such as terrain, weather, and riding style can all impact battery performance. For example, riding uphill or on rough terrain will consume more power than riding on flat, smooth surfaces. Wind resistance can also affect range; a headwind can require significantly more energy, whereas a tailwind can help extend range. Furthermore, extreme temperatures can affect battery efficiency, as cold weather generally reduces battery capacity.

4. Rider Weight and Cargo


The total weight that an e-bike must carry is also crucial to its range. Heavier riders or additional cargo means the motor has to work harder to provide assistance, which can decrease the overall distance the bike can travel on a single charge. If you plan to carry significant gear, consider choosing a bike designed to accommodate added weight or opt for lighter accessories to extend your range.


5. Tire Pressure and Maintenance


Proper tire pressure greatly affects rolling resistance, which in turn influences range. Under-inflated tires create more drag and require more energy to ride, thereby shortening the range. It's essential to regularly check and maintain your bike for optimal performance. This includes keeping the chain lubricated, ensuring brakes are functioning correctly, and checking that electrical connections are clean and secure.


6. Riding Habits


Your riding style has a tangible impact on the e-bike's range. Aggressive acceleration, rapid deceleration, and frequent stopping and starting can drain the battery faster than a smooth, steady ride. Learning to pedal efficiently in conjunction with the motor—using the right gears and maintaining a steady pace—can significantly extend your e-bike's range.
